What are clauses and relative clauses?

A clause is part of a sentence which is composed of a subject and a predicate.

Relative clauses are types of clauses that modify nouns and noun phrases. They are linked with pronouns such as: who, whose, which, that etc.

The pronouns in a relative clause are relative pronouns that link to the antecedent in a sentence.
